When to Build a Custom CRM
Off-the-shelf tools are great until they force your team to work around them. If you recognize any of the scenarios below, a custom CRM (or a focused extension around WordPress/WooCommerce) will pay back quickly:
- Process mismatch: sales/ops steps don’t map to the rigid pipeline of a generic tool; too many fields in the wrong places.
- Data fragmentation: orders in WooCommerce, quotes in spreadsheets, service tickets in email — no single source of truth.
- Manual handoffs: lead routing, approvals, reminders and follow-ups require Slack/Email ping-pong.
- Integration limits: ERP, accounting, inventory, logistics or marketing data can’t sync reliably or in near-real-time.
- Security & roles: you need nuanced, role-based access, audit trails, data residency and compliance controls.
| Criteria | Off-the-shelf CRM | Custom CRM |
|---|---|---|
| Fit to workflow | 80% fit, 20% workarounds | 100% mapped to your process |
| Ownership | Vendor lock-in, per-seat pricing | You own features, data, and roadmap |
| Integrations | Limited connectors, polling | API-first, event-driven, idempotent jobs |
| Security & roles | Predefined role sets | Granular roles, field-level rules, audit |
| Reporting | Generic dashboards | KPIs tailored to ops & finance |

Discovery & Architecture
Before writing a line of code, we map your business processes and data flows to design a system that is lean, extensible and secure.
Process Mapping
- Lead → Quote → Order → Fulfillment → Service
- Manufacturing: BOM, production slots, QC, dispatch
- Retail: catalog, stock, promotions, returns
Data Modeling
- Entities: Accounts, Contacts, Deals, Assets
- Custom objects: Machines, Lots, Batches, Tickets
- Relations, lifecycle states, audit requirements
Technical Blueprint
- Architecture: monolith + services where needed
- APIs: REST/GraphQL, webhooks, message queues
- Performance & scalability budgets
Integrations (ERP/WP/Email)
We build robust, idempotent integrations around your stack. WordPress/WooCommerce can act as the storefront, while the CRM orchestrates sales, fulfillment and service.
| System | Direction | Events / Entities |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| WooCommerce / WordPress | Bi-directional | Customers, Orders, Products, Coupons | Sync pricing/stock, order status, RFM scoring; logged web events. |
| ERP / Inventory | Bi-directional | Items, Batches, Stock, Work Orders | Reserve stock, push delivery dates, production slots, QC results. |
| Email & Calendar | Ingest & push | Threads, Tasks, Meetings | Auto-attach emails to deals, SLA timers, follow-up tasks. |
| Accounting | Bi-directional | Invoices, Payments, Credit Notes | Revenue attribution, aging, margin views per deal/segment. |
| Marketing | Bi-directional | Segments, Campaigns, Events | Lead scoring, lifecycle automation, consent records. |

Automation & Workflows
Replace manual handoffs with deterministic workflows. Below — examples we regularly implement.
Lead Routing
- Assign by territory, product line or SLA load
- Auto-enrich company data and duplicate checks
- Escalation when no activity within N hours
Quote to Order
- Template quotes by segment & discount rules
- Approval chains (manager → finance → legal)
- Order creation + stock reservation in ERP
After-Sales / Service
- Warranty registration tied to serial/lot
- Preventive maintenance reminders
- RMA workflow with courier labels
Marketing & Retention
- Segment by RFM, churn risk, product usage
- Automated “win-back” and replenishment flows
- Event-based emails/SMS with consent logging
Security & Roles
Security is designed in from day one: least privilege, auditable changes, encrypted transport and backups, and clear boundaries between data domains.
| Capability | Description | Typical Use |
|---|---|---|
| Role-based Access | Permission sets on objects, fields, actions | Sales can view margin %, edit price only with approval |
| Audit Trails | Who changed what and when (diffs, IP, client) | Compliance, incident response, rollback context |
| Data Protection | TLS, encrypted backups, rotation, limited retention | GDPR-aligned storage & deletion policies |
| SSO & MFA | Identity provider integration, step-up authentication | Reduce credential sprawl, secure high-risk actions |

How We Deliver
- Discovery (1–2 weeks): stakeholder interviews, process maps, data model, risk & ROI hypotheses.
- Blueprint (1 week): system architecture, integration contracts, role model, acceptance criteria.
- Incremental build (2-week sprints): backlog, demos, release notes, UAT, performance gates.
- Hardening & launch: security checks, backup/rollback plan, documentation and training.
- Support & growth: monitoring, SLA, roadmap of automation and reporting enhancements.
